Productive Toolbox

Remove Duplicate Lines

Clean up text by removing duplicate lines instantly with advanced options

Input Text

Lines: 1

Output Text

Processing Options

Remove Duplicate Lines Tool for Faster List Cleanup and Cleaner Text Data

This free Remove Duplicate Lines tool helps you clean repeated line-based text quickly. It is useful for writers, marketers, analysts, and developers managing lists, logs, and text exports.

Instead of manually scanning long lists, you can deduplicate, sort, and format entries with clear controls and instant results.

Why This Tool Is Better Than Basic Alternatives

Flexible duplicate handling

Switch between unique-output mode and duplicate-only mode depending on your data cleanup goal.

Practical preprocessing controls

Trim whitespace, normalize letter case, and remove empty lines before matching for cleaner dedupe logic.

Workflow-friendly actions

Paste, upload, drag-drop, auto process, auto copy, and export output without switching tools.

Clear result metrics

Track total lines, duplicates removed, remaining lines, and removed empty lines in one view.

Many dedupe tools only remove exact matches. This one provides deeper control for real-world noisy data.

How to Use Remove Duplicate Lines

  1. 1Paste text, upload a file, or drag and drop your line list.
  2. 2Set processing options such as ignore case, trim whitespace, and remove empty lines.
  3. 3Choose optional sort and text transform behavior.
  4. 4Run Remove Duplicates or enable auto process for instant updates.
  5. 5Copy or download the cleaned output and review summary stats.

Option Guide

Ignore Case

Matches lines case-insensitively so casing differences do not create false uniques.

Trim Whitespace

Removes leading and trailing spaces before matching to avoid spacing-based duplicates.

Remove Empty Lines

Filters out blank rows to keep output focused on meaningful entries.

Keep Only Duplicates

Extracts repeated lines only for auditing and quality checks.

Sort Order

Keeps original order, sorts ascending/descending, or randomizes output.

Text Transform

Applies uppercase, lowercase, or capitalize formatting before dedupe.

Practical Use Cases

Email and contact list cleanup

Remove repeated entries before campaign imports and CRM updates.

Keyword and URL list deduplication

Clean research lists for SEO workflows and reporting tasks.

CSV line normalization

Filter duplicate rows from single-column exports and text extracts.

Log and error list review

Keep distinct entries for clearer debugging and issue triage.

Content and prompt list maintenance

Merge repeated text lines in writing, automation, and QA documents.

Data quality checks

Use duplicate-only mode to identify repeated items in source datasets.

Common Deduplication Mistakes to Avoid

  • -Running dedupe without choosing correct case-sensitivity behavior.
  • -Skipping whitespace trimming when input has inconsistent spacing.
  • -Using sorted output when original sequence order must be preserved.
  • -Forgetting duplicate-only mode when auditing repeated records.
  • -Copying output before validating final option settings.

Frequently Asked Questions

What does a remove duplicate lines tool do?

It scans line-by-line text input, removes repeated entries, and returns a cleaned list based on your selected matching rules.

Why is this tool better than basic duplicate removers?

It includes options for case handling, whitespace trimming, empty-line removal, duplicate-only mode, sorting, text transforms, and quick copy or download.

Can I ignore case when checking duplicates?

Yes. Enable ignore-case mode to treat lines like Apple and apple as duplicates.

Can I remove blank lines while cleaning text?

Yes. The remove-empty-lines option removes empty rows before final output.

What is keep-only-duplicates mode?

Instead of returning unique lines, it returns only entries that appeared more than once.

Can I sort the final output?

Yes. You can keep original order, sort A-Z, sort Z-A, or randomize output order.

Can I transform text before deduplication?

Yes. You can apply uppercase, lowercase, or capitalize transformations before duplicate processing.

Can I upload a file instead of pasting text?

Yes. You can upload or drag-and-drop supported text files such as .txt and .csv.

Is this remove duplicate lines tool free?

Yes. It is free to use without registration.

Is my text private?

Yes. Processing happens in your browser and does not require sending content to external servers.

Clean Repeated Lines Faster and Keep Text Datasets More Reliable

With precise matching options, instant feedback, and export-ready output, this tool helps teams reduce manual cleanup effort and improve line-based data quality.